compose.desktop {
application {
mainClass = "org.meshtastic.desktop.MainKt"
// CMP resolves javaHome from the JVM running Gradle, not the Kotlin toolchain. On CI
// that's Temurin 25, which ships without jmods (JEP 493): jlink still works, but the
// ProGuard task derives -libraryjars from $javaHome/jmods and fails with ~857k
// unresolved java.* references. Pin packaging to the JBR SDK toolchain (jmods
// included) so ProGuard sees the platform classes and the bundled runtime is
// deterministically JBR 25 on every machine.
//
// This assignment must stay EAGER here on the extension. Deferring it to lazy
// `tasks.withType<AbstractProguardTask>().configureEach { javaHome.set(provider) }` (PR #6401)
// does not reach `proguardReleaseJars` — the extension value still wins, ProGuard relaunches
// under the Gradle JVM, and every Build Desktop leg goes red with the jmods-less signature.
javaHome =
javaToolchains
.launcherFor {
languageVersion.set(JavaLanguageVersion.of(25))
vendor.set(JvmVendorSpec.JETBRAINS)
}
.get()
.metadata
.installationPath
.asFile
.absolutePath
